Don's Auto Repair
5
4
3
2
1
Review highlights
"Always able to fit you in quickly, reasonable pricing, and friendly! I heart Don’s."
"Great people, great service, great price."
"Quality and fast work at great prices."
Overview
Hours
Sunday
Closed
Monday
8:30 AM - 6:00 PM
Tuesday
8:30 AM - 6:00 PM
Wednesday
8:30 AM - 6:00 PM
Thursday
8:30 AM - 6:00 PM
Friday
8:30 AM - 6:00 PM
Saturday
8:30 AM - 1:00 PM
Reviews (26)
Feb 05, 2025
Exlente lugar
Feb 01, 2025
I’ve trusted Don’s for all my oil changes, inspections, and other automotive needs over the past several years and highly recommend them. Extremely trustworthy, fair pricing, and a very nice group of people. You will not be disappointed!
Jan 31, 2025
Honest, thorough and timely! A great, dependable family business, which is hard to come by. Definitely recommend
Jan 17, 2025
Don is the best. As a woman in the city, it’s tough for me to trust people with my car. Don has always been very fair with pricing and is very communicative along the way. I thought my car was done for when eats chewed something up but he didn’t give up and found and fixed the problem. He always is able to squeeze me in as well. Highly recommend!
Jan 10, 2025
They are super friendly and always trying to get things done quickly and efficiently. Super happy to have Don’s around the corner.
Jan 07, 2025
AVOID DON’S AUTO AT ALL COSTS. This place is the definition of shady, unprofessional, and disrespectful. Not only did they ruin my car, but they also had the audacity to gaslight me into believing it was my fault, and wouldn't guarantee their work. I took my car in for a simple brake pad change and inspection. When they gave me a return call (which I had to specifically request), they said I needed a new brake drum and spring, but I couldn't completely understand them because they don't speak English well and rushed me on the phone. I said "fine" Big mistake. When I went to pick up the car, they slapped me with an almost $600 bill. The owner’s wife smugly told me it was a “good price, such a deal,” and had the nerve to suggest I should be grateful because “it should have cost more because it’s an older car.” Absolute nonsense—I’ve never been charged that much for brakes and inspection. And upsold on top of it. But wait, it gets worse. On the drive home for Thanksgiving, the car started wobbling on the highway at speeds over 60 mph. Like the whole car was actually shaking, and it felt totally unsafe! This issue never existed before. So I took it back to Don’s to ask if they could take a look at it. Their response? “Not our fault.” They denied they had any hand in it and couldn't tell me why the issue was happening, then quoted me over $100 for a tire rotation to “fix” their mess, but weren't sure if that would fix it. I decided to think it over and told them I’d pick up my car later. When I arrived to get my car, they had parked it on the street. As soon as I went to unfold the driver’s side mirror, I realized it was completely broken, loose, and bent backwards. It was fine the morning I brought it in, and I personally saw them pull it into the garage without issue. This means one of two things: they either broke it intentionally or left it unfolded in the street for someone else to break. Either way, the result was the same—now, if I accelerate too fast, it limply folds into the door, and if I brake, it's falls to the front. It's totally loose. I immediately called them (I mean I immediately called them, not five minutes after I realized the issue). I was stressed and frustrated. I was met with the same dismissive attitude: “You shouldn’t have driven it away. We can’t guarantee it now.” Are you kidding me? What kind of shop doesn’t take accountability for damaging a customer’s car? I drove back again, only to have Don avoid eye contact for 10 minutes and repeat the phrase, “If you drove it away, it’s not my fault” and saying "Pepboys would do the same" Once he was done gaslighting me, he offered to tape my mirror up as a “solution.” Yes, tape. My mirror is still broken. I’ve been left with nothing but frustration and an unsafe vehicle that still wobbles on the highway. Don's is a joke. My car was perfectly fine before I brought it there. They don’t stand by their work, they don’t respect their customers, and they will leave your car in worse condition than when you brought it in. Do yourself a favor and take your car somewhere else.
Dec 07, 2024
Do not come here for your inspection, they will take all your money! Pros: very quick, super efficient Cons: he charges 5 times the costs and adds stuff without your permission. I originally came for an inspection sticker, and Dom told me he couldn’t give me an emission pass without changing my brake shoes. He told me it would cost me somewhere $300-$400 and I accepted and left my car yesterday. This morning, I came to pick up the car and paid $725 bc he told me he added springs and cylinders($195 each) while he was changing my brake shoes, which we never talked or I never agreed on , never received a call about it. Also which later I realized they come as a pack anyway ($85 alltogether) when you order brake shoes. So I paid almost 5 times the cost!!! Thanks, I won’t be back.
Dec 07, 2024
Don’s the man - I’ve been coming here for close to 10 years now without a single complaint. Good prices, good work and fast! Would recommend to anyone needing a legitimate & honest mechanic
Dec 07, 2024
Fast and reasonable prices
Nov 07, 2024
Call to asking a question this dude don’t even listen to me at all all he said I don’t do this thing anyway then hang up very unprofessional 👎🏽👎🏽👎🏽👎🏽👎🏽👎🏽👎🏽
Nov 07, 2024
Friend told me about the garage since I needed an oil change. Got fast and quality service so I came back again recently to get my brakes changed too. 10/10 would recommend.
Nov 07, 2024
Great local auto repair shop. Knowledgeable, professional, & friendly. Reasonable rates, very organized shop area. I was referred to them and will do all of my auto maintenance with them going forward. Highly recommend.
Nov 07, 2024
I was new in PA and went for an annual inspection and a tire repair. The guy there did a sloppy job leaving many scratches on my tint when they applied the inspection stickers. They could’ve been more careful or coordinated with me when the first obvious scratch appeared. So disappointed. I chose this shop because of many recommendations. Now I have to pay about $400 to repair and reinstall my formula one tint. Update October 18, 2024: I gave them a call today and wanted to discuss the scratches on the inner side of the windshield where they put to stickers. After a second look, I recently realized the damage they did was not only on the tint but also on the windshield. The lead staff picked up my call and he was very rude. They made a mistake, messed up my windshield and tint, and they gave me a terrible attitude. In the end, before that man hung up my call, I had his words saying if there are actual scratches on the windshield inside after I take off the tint, I can go find them. So I’m making an update here as part of evidence.
Nov 07, 2024
Quality and fast work at great prices. Family-run and all are welcome!
Oct 07, 2024
Best in the biz and trustworthy! Have been working with them for years. Thank you!
Oct 07, 2024
Fantastic
Sep 07, 2024
Been going here years, awesome quality of service.
Sep 07, 2024
Everyone was friendly, service was fast and efficient. I will only ever come back here for service on my vehicle as long as I live in Philadelphia. *Adding to my review 4 years later*- I can confidently say Don’s is still THE best place to bring your car. I recommend them to everyone I meet in Philly with a car. I came for an inspection today. I called the night before and they recommended I give them a call on my way in the morning so they can help me get around some road closings. I did this, and was given perfect directions. The inspection was quick and easy. Seriously, if you’re not coming to Don’s, you’re doing it wrong!
Aug 07, 2024
Great service and experience at a fair price. I scheduled an appointment, ran 30 mins late, but they were still able to get me in and out within the hour for a vehicle inspection! I was also really worried about getting shaken down for unnecessary work by private inspectors (I come from New Jersey, land of state vehicle inspections), but had no problems whatsoever here. Very honest—I'll bring my business here in the future.
Aug 07, 2024
I needed to get an oil change quickly and Don's was able to do it with ease. They even took a look at my car for other questions I had about driving across the country. SUCH a reasonable price for the services and very efficient. I will be coming back here for sure!
Aug 07, 2024
I’ve been visiting Don a lot the past two months because my car has had a lot of issues, and every single visit has been great. They are super reasonable, timely, and best of all, direct! They tell me how long it’ll take, what is/isn’t within their limits, and what happened. I will continue to visit them 🫶🫡
Aug 07, 2024
The reviews don’t lie. I took my car to Dons Auto solely because of the great reviews he had. I am not from Philly and was shooting in the dark trying to find a mechanic. Don fixed my car super fast. I told him my budget and he did the work with money left over. Awesome shop! Super honest mechanics that try to help you instead of profiting off you.
Aug 07, 2024
They were fast, friendly, and communicative with my service and did a great job of accommodating my timeline with ease. Great place!
Jul 07, 2024
Don and team have worked on all my cars over the past several years. No need to go anywhere else. Great everything
Jul 07, 2024
Don will get it DONE (and for cheap!)
Jul 07, 2024
Don's is great, every time I've brought my car to them for work they have diagnosed & repaired the issue faster and for less than I was expecting. You just need to understand it's a smaller shop, so you may have to wait a week before they have availability. Though, I would rather wait a week for a repair I can trust, then be able to drop off my car right away but need it brought back multiple times for the same issue. tl;dr Don's is great, just call ahead.